Identifying Biases and Fallacies
Human beings are prone to a variety of cognitive biases that can cloud judgment and lead to irrational decision-making. The gambler’s fallacy, for example, is the belief that past events influence future independent events. Similarly, confirmation bias can lead players to selectively focus on information that confirms their existing beliefs while ignoring contradictory evidence. Recognizing these biases is the first step towards overcoming them. A critical and objective approach to data analysis is essential for avoiding these pitfalls and making sound strategic decisions. Being aware of these mental shortcuts is paramount for maintaining a logical and profitable approach.
- Gambler’s Fallacy: Believing past events influence independent outcomes.
- Confirmation Bias: Seeking information confirming existing beliefs.
- Anchoring Bias: Over-reliance on initial pieces of information.
- Loss Aversion: Feeling the pain of a loss more strongly than the pleasure of an equivalent gain.
- Availability Heuristic: Overestimating the likelihood of events that are easily recalled.
